beam |
a long, strong piece of wood or metal used to support floors, ceilings or roofs. |
compass |
an instrument for showing direction. A typical compass has a moving magnetic needle that points north. |
confusion |
the state of not understanding clearly or of being mixed up. |
deceive |
to cause to believe something that is not true; trick or fool. |
differ |
to be not the same as; be unlike. |
insurance |
a protection against certain accidents that is provided by a company in return for payment of a fee. |
prevention |
the act or process of keeping something unwanted or dangerous from happening. |
rink |
a smooth surface of ice used for ice skating or ice hockey. |
sauce |
a liquid dressing or topping served with food. |
settle |
to finally agree upon or decide. |
stake1 |
a sharpened or pointed post that is driven into the ground. Stakes can be used to mark a place or to support something. |
tide |
the flowing of water away from or back onto the land. |
vent |
an opening through which a gas or vapor can enter, pass through, or exit. |
vibrate |
to move back and forth very rapidly and steadily. |
whereas |
while in contrast. |
